VIRGINIA BEACH, Virginia - The Virginia Wesleyan women's tennis team defeated the Hawks of Chowan University, in their home opener at the Everett Tennis Center in Virginia Beach, VA.

INSIDE THE RESULTS
- The Hawks got the best of the Marlins in doubles action winning 8-4 and 8-2 at doubles No. 1 and No. 2 respectively.
- In singles action, Alexa Brewster downed CU's No. 1 player 6-1, 6-1.
- Christine Zalameda picked up a win at singles No. 2 with scores of 6-4, 6-2.
- VWU collected team points from three forfeits by the Hawks at doubles No. 3 and singles No. 5 & No. 6.
- Anna Rogers dropped her match at No. 3 singles 6-0, 6-3, while Amanda Stegemann took a game in each set falling 6-1, 6-1, at No. 4 singles.
